Prime Minister Narendra Modi will inaugurate Rewa Airport, Vindhya will get a new flight

Prime Minister Narendra Modi will inaugurate the newly constructed Rewa Airport through virtual medium from Banaras on Sunday. After Bhopal, Jabalpur, Khajuraho, Indore and Gwalior, Rewa will be the sixth airport in the state to get license from DGCA. More than 65 lakh people of the state will benefit from the opening of Rewa Airport. Districts connected to Rewa will benefit directly

Mauganj, Sidhi, Satna and Maihar districts are directly connected to Rewa. Along with these districts, people from the borders of Uttar Pradesh and Chhattisgarh also come to Rewa for their work. The population of Rewa is around 15 lakh, Mauganj is 8 lakh, Sidhi is 12 lakh, Singrauli is 12 lakh and Satna district is 18 lakh. All of them will get direct benefits from the airport. Rewa Airport has been built under the government’s UDAN (Ude Desh ka Aam Nagrik) scheme. This airport has been designed keeping in mind the needs of the next 50 years.

Rewa airport at a glance

  • Total Cost: Rs 450 crore.
  • Land Area: 102 hectares.
  • Runway Width: 30 meters.
  • Runway Length: 800 meters.
  • Two 3.5 meter shelters on either side of the runway.
  • Flights of passenger and cargo planes.
  • 72 seater flight services will start for Bhopal.

Preparations for regional industrial conference

After the inauguration of the airport, the Chief Minister will communicate with the industrialists of Rewa and Shahdol divisions about the regional industrial conference to be held on October 23. Industrialists from Rewa will participate in this dialogue on the spot, while industrialists from other districts will join through video conferencing.
